The scope of a tax refers to the specific parameters that define which individuals, entities, income, transactions, or assets are subject to that tax. It delineates the legal boundaries within which a government can impose a financial obligation.

What is the scope of the power to tax?
As a general rule, the power to tax is an incident of sovereignty and is unlimited in its range, acknowledging in its very nature no limits, so that security against its abuse is to be found only in the responsibility of the legislature which imposes the tax on the constituency who are to pay it.

What is 50% 40% of salary in ITR?
The exemption limit is the lowest of the three heads mentioned: Actual HRA Received. 50% of (Basic salary + Dearness Allowance) for those living in Metro Cities / 40% for those living in Non-Metro cities. Actual Rent paid (-) 10% of Basic Salary + DA.
Who has the power to tax?
Article I, Section 8, Clause 1: The Congress shall have Power To lay and collect Taxes, Duties, Imposts and Excises, to pay the Debts and provide for the common Defence and general Welfare of the United States; but all Duties, Imposts and Excises shall be uniform throughout the United States; . . .

What is the meaning of out of scope tax?
Out-of-scope supplies are transactions that, for various reasons defined in UAE VAT law, are not subject to VAT. These transactions fall entirely outside the VAT system, meaning: No VAT is charged. No input tax can be recovered.

What is the scope of Section 154 of Income Tax Act?
As per section 154, any mistake apparent from the record can be rectified by the Income Tax Authorities in following cases: a) Any order passed under any provisions of the Income-tax Act. b) Any intimation or deemed intimation sent under section 143(1).

What are the types of taxes?
Taxes are of two distinct types: direct and indirect taxes. The difference comes in the way these taxes are implemented. Some are paid directly by you, such as the dreaded income tax, wealth tax, corporate tax, etc., while others are indirect taxes, such as the value-added tax, service tax, sales tax, etc.
